Working TitleOffice Assistant Pay$12.00 Hourly CampusGallup DepartmentGallup Student Advisement (155A) Employment TypeStudent Employment Student TypeWork-Study StatusNon-Exempt Background Check RequiredNo For Best Consideration Date11/21/2025 Position Summary Position Summary: Under close supervision, student will be expected to provide administrative support such as covering the front desk with student intake and screening, answering telephones, creating forms, distributing flyers, scanning documents, preparing confidential documents for shredding and proctoring services for Accuplacer and other testing room needs. Other duties may include simple clerical duties such as but not limited to filing, sorting forms and records, provide general office information to staff, students and faculty, check mail, log incoming and outgoing mail as needed. Must have computer, telephone and customer service skills. Will run department errands as needed, will be working with confidential information and records. Will work with advisor as needed.
